Generador de Redirecciones Nginx: Una Herramienta Gratuita y Esencial para Desarrolladores

La gestión de redirecciones es una parte fundamental del desarrollo web, especialmente al migrar sitios, cambiar URLs o mejorar la estructura de enlaces. El Generador de Redirecciones Nginx es una herramienta gratuita que simplifica el proceso de creación de configuraciones de redirección para servidores Nginx y archivos .htaccess. A continuación, exploraremos sus características clave, cómo utilizarla paso a paso, ejemplos reales y consejos útiles.

¿Qué hace el Generador de Redirecciones Nginx?

El Generador de Redirecciones Nginx permite a los desarrolladores generar configuraciones de redirección de manera rápida y sencilla. Con esta herramienta, puedes crear reglas de redirección de acuerdo a tus necesidades específicas, soportando distintos tipos de redirecciones:

  • 301: Redirección permanente
  • 302: Redirección temporal
  • 307: Redirección temporal, manteniendo el método original
  • 308: Redirección permanente, manteniendo el método original
  • Esto significa que puedes adaptar tus redirecciones según el contexto, asegurando que los motores de búsqueda y los navegadores manejen las URLs de la manera más efectiva.

    Características Clave

  • Interfaz Intuitiva: La herramienta presenta una interfaz sencilla que permite generar redirecciones en cuestión de minutos.
  • Soporte para Varias Reglas: Puedes crear múltiples redirecciones en una sola sesión, facilitando la gestión de cambios masivos.
  • Compatibilidad: Genera configuraciones tanto para Nginx como para .htaccess, lo que la hace versátil para diferentes entornos de servidor.
  • Exportación Fácil: Las configuraciones generadas se pueden copiar fácilmente para integrarlas en tus archivos de configuración.
  • Cómo Utilizar el Generador de Redirecciones Nginx: Paso a Paso

    1. Accede a la Herramienta: Visita el sitio web del Generador de Redirecciones Nginx.

    2. Selecciona el Tipo de Redirección: Elige entre 301, 302, 307 o 308 según tus necesidades.

    3. Ingresa las URLs:

    - En el campo "Desde", escribe la URL antigua que deseas redirigir.

    - En el campo "Hacia", escribe la nueva URL a la que deseas que se dirija el tráfico.

    4. Añade Más Reglas: Si necesitas más redirecciones, puedes añadir nuevas entradas fácilmente.

    5. Genera la Configuración: Haz clic en el botón de generar. La herramienta generará automáticamente el código de redirección correspondiente.

    6. Copiar y Pegar: Copia el código generado y pégalo en tu archivo de configuración de Nginx o en el archivo .htaccess, según sea necesario.

    Ejemplos Reales de Uso

    Ejemplo 1: Redirección Permanente (301)

    Supón que has cambiado la URL de un artículo en tu blog. Utilizarías la siguiente configuración:

    • Desde: `/articulo-antiguo`
    • Hacia: `/articulo-nuevo`

    El generador proporcionaría el siguiente código:

    ```nginx

    rewrite ^/articulo-antiguo$ /articulo-nuevo permanent;

    ```

    Ejemplo 2: Redirección Temporal (302)

    Si estás realizando pruebas en una página y no quieres perder tráfico, puedes hacer una redirección temporal:

    • Desde: `/pagina-en-mantenimiento`
    • Hacia: `/pagina-nueva`

    El resultado sería:

    ```nginx

    rewrite ^/pagina-en-mantenimiento$ /pagina-nueva redirect;

    ```

    Ejemplo 3: Redirección 307

    Si deseas mantener el método HTTP original (como POST), usarías:

    • Desde: `/formulario`
    • Hacia: `/nuevo-formulario`

    La configuración generada sería:

    ```nginx

    error_page 418 =307 /nuevo-formulario;

    ```

    ¿Quiénes se Benefician?

    El Generador de Redirecciones Nginx es útil para:

  • Desarrolladores Web: Quienes necesitan gestionar redirecciones de manera eficiente.
  • SEO Specialists: Que buscan optimizar la visibilidad de sus sitios al manejar cambios en URLs.
  • Administradores de Sistemas: Que requieren implementar redirecciones en servidores Nginx sin complicaciones.
  • Consejos y Trucos

  • Prueba Antes de Implementar: Siempre prueba las redirecciones en un entorno de desarrollo antes de aplicarlas en producción.
  • Utiliza Comentarios: Añade comentarios en tu archivo de configuración para recordar el propósito de cada redirección.
  • Monitorea el Tráfico: Después de implementar redirecciones, utiliza herramientas de análisis para asegurarte de que el tráfico se está dirigiendo correctamente.
  • El Generador de Redirecciones Nginx es una herramienta valiosa para cualquier desarrollador que busca simplificar la gestión de redirecciones. Su facilidad de uso y capacidad para generar configuraciones precisas la convierten en un recurso indispensable para mantener la integridad y eficiencia de un sitio web.